(1) Except as provided in subsection (2) of this section, if the local government does not make a decision on an expedited land division within 63 days after the application is deemed complete, the applicant may apply in the circuit court for the county in which the application was filed for a writ of mandamus to compel the local government to issue the approval. The writ shall be issued unless the local government shows that the approval would violate a substantive provision of the applicable land use regulations or the requirements of ORS 197.360. A decision of the circuit court under this section may be appealed only to the Court of Appeals.
(2) After seven days' notice to the applicant, the governing body of the local government may, at a regularly scheduled public meeting, take action to extend the 63-day time period to a date certain for one or more applications for an expedited land division prior to the expiration of the 63-day period, based on a determination that an unexpected or extraordinary increase in applications makes action within 63 days impracticable. In no case shall an extension be to a date more than 120 days after the application was deemed complete. Upon approval of an extension, the provisions of ORS 197.360 to 197.380, including the mandamus remedy provided by subsection (1) of this section, shall remain applicable to the expedited land division, except that the extended period shall be substituted for the 63-day period wherever applicable.
(3) The decision to approve or not approve an extension under subsection (2) of this section is not a land use decision or limited land use decision.
